🔐 Atlas Authentication API Guide

Complete frontend integration guide for Atlas authentication system

📋 Quick Reference

Endpoint Method Purpose Auth Required
/api/auth/register POST Create new user account No
/api/auth/login POST Login existing user No
/api/auth/refresh POST Refresh access token No*
/api/auth/logout POST Logout user No*
/api/auth/me GET Get current user profile Yes

Base URL: http://localhost:3001 (development)


🚀 Getting Started

Authentication Flow Overview

  1. Registration/Login → Get access & refresh tokens
  2. Store tokens securely (localStorage/sessionStorage)
  3. Include access token in all authenticated requests
  4. Refresh tokens when they expire (15min lifetime)
  5. Logout to revoke tokens

💻 Frontend Implementation Examples

React/JavaScript Integration

// auth.service.ts
class AuthService {
  private baseURL = 'http://localhost:3001/api/auth';
  private accessToken: string | null = null;
  private refreshToken: string | null = null;

  constructor() {
    // Load tokens from storage on init
    this.accessToken = localStorage.getItem('accessToken');
    this.refreshToken = localStorage.getItem('refreshToken');
  }

  // Register new user
  async register(userData: {
    name: string;
    username: string;
    email: string;
    password: string;
  }) {
    const response = await fetch(`${this.baseURL}/register`, {
      method: 'POST',
      headers: {
        'Content-Type': 'application/json',
      },
      body: JSON.stringify(userData),
    });

    const data = await response.json();
    
    if (data.success) {
      this.setTokens(data.data.tokens);
      return data.data.user;
    } else {
      throw new Error(data.message || 'Registration failed');
    }
  }

  // Login existing user
  async login(username: string, password: string) {
    const response = await fetch(`${this.baseURL}/login`, {
      method: 'POST',
      headers: {
        'Content-Type': 'application/json',
      },
      body: JSON.stringify({ username, password }),
    });

    const data = await response.json();
    
    if (data.success) {
      this.setTokens(data.data.tokens);
      return data.data.user;
    } else {
      throw new Error(data.message || 'Login failed');
    }
  }

  // Get current user profile
  async getCurrentUser() {
    const response = await this.authenticatedRequest(`${this.baseURL}/me`);
    const data = await response.json();
    
    if (data.success) {
      return data.data.user;
    } else {
      throw new Error(data.message || 'Failed to get user profile');
    }
  }

  // Refresh access token
  async refreshAccessToken() {
    if (!this.refreshToken) {
      throw new Error('No refresh token available');
    }

    const response = await fetch(`${this.baseURL}/refresh`, {
      method: 'POST',
      headers: {
        'Content-Type': 'application/json',
      },
      body: JSON.stringify({ refreshToken: this.refreshToken }),
    });

    const data = await response.json();
    
    if (data.success) {
      this.accessToken = data.data.accessToken;
      localStorage.setItem('accessToken', this.accessToken!);
      return this.accessToken;
    } else {
      // Refresh failed, need to login again
      this.logout();
      throw new Error('Session expired, please login again');
    }
  }

  // Logout user
  async logout() {
    if (this.refreshToken) {
      try {
        await fetch(`${this.baseURL}/logout`, {
          method: 'POST',
          headers: {
            'Content-Type': 'application/json',
          },
          body: JSON.stringify({ refreshToken: this.refreshToken }),
        });
      } catch (error) {
        console.warn('Logout request failed:', error);
      }
    }

    // Clear tokens regardless of API call success
    this.clearTokens();
  }

  // Make authenticated requests with automatic token refresh
  async authenticatedRequest(url: string, options: RequestInit = {}) {
    if (!this.accessToken) {
      throw new Error('No access token available');
    }

    // First attempt with current token
    let response = await fetch(url, {
      ...options,
      headers: {
        ...options.headers,
        'Authorization': `Bearer ${this.accessToken}`,
      },
    });

    // If token expired, try to refresh and retry
    if (response.status === 401) {
      try {
        await this.refreshAccessToken();
        
        // Retry with new token
        response = await fetch(url, {
          ...options,
          headers: {
            ...options.headers,
            'Authorization': `Bearer ${this.accessToken}`,
          },
        });
      } catch (refreshError) {
        throw new Error('Authentication failed, please login again');
      }
    }

    return response;
  }

  // Token management helpers
  private setTokens(tokens: {
    accessToken: string;
    refreshToken: string;
    expiresIn: number;
  }) {
    this.accessToken = tokens.accessToken;
    this.refreshToken = tokens.refreshToken;
    
    // Store in localStorage (consider more secure options for production)
    localStorage.setItem('accessToken', tokens.accessToken);
    localStorage.setItem('refreshToken', tokens.refreshToken);
  }

  private clearTokens() {
    this.accessToken = null;
    this.refreshToken = null;
    localStorage.removeItem('accessToken');
    localStorage.removeItem('refreshToken');
  }

  // Check if user is logged in
  isAuthenticated(): boolean {
    return !!this.accessToken;
  }

  // Get current access token
  getAccessToken(): string | null {
    return this.accessToken;
  }
}

// Export singleton instance
export const authService = new AuthService();

⚠️ Important Security Notes

1. Token Storage

  • Development: localStorage is fine
  • Production: Consider more secure options:
    • httpOnly cookies
    • Secure sessionStorage
    • In-memory storage with persistence strategy

2. HTTPS Only

  • Always use HTTPS in production
  • Tokens transmitted over HTTP are vulnerable

3. Token Expiration

  • Access tokens expire in 15 minutes
  • Refresh tokens expire in 7 days
  • Implement automatic token refresh in your HTTP client

4. Error Handling

  • Always check response.success before using data
  • Handle network errors gracefully
  • Provide user-friendly error messages

📋 Validation Rules

Registration

  • Name: 2-100 characters, letters/numbers/spaces/hyphens/underscores only
  • Username: 3-30 characters, letters/numbers/hyphens/underscores only, unique
  • Email: Valid email format, unique
  • Password: Minimum 6 characters

Rate Limits

  • Registration: 5 attempts per 15 minutes per IP
  • Login: 10 attempts per 15 minutes per IP
  • General API: 1000 requests per 15 minutes per IP

🚨 Common Issues & Solutions

Issue: "Authentication required" on valid requests

Solution: Check that Authorization header is properly formatted: Bearer <token>

Issue: Token refresh fails

Solution: Clear all tokens and redirect to login - refresh token may have expired

Issue: CORS errors

Solution: API is configured for localhost:3000 and localhost:5173 - update your dev server port

Issue: Registration fails with validation errors

Solution: Check that all required fields meet validation criteria
